Escaping AbuseLesson 3: Making The Break For GoodDreams and GoalsMost people have hidden talents, dreams, and great ideas. We tend to put our true passions aside due to fear and lack of confidence. Some people will turn their passions into hobbies and work outside of the home doing something they dread and find themselves unhappy at their jobs. But it doesn't have to be this way. We all have the power to make our dreams come true. Exercise #1 What are your dreams? What have you always wanted to do with your life? What have you always wanted to accomplish? Exercise #2 Do you have a craft? Do you have a hobby? What are they? Could you make your hobbies into a moneymaking business? If so, what do you need to do? What materials do you need to start with? Exercise #3 Have you ever thought about going to college? If you had the opportunity to go to college, what would you go for? Why? Exercise #4 Keep a Diary of Dreams. Browse through magazines, newspapers, brochures, newsletters, books, and any kind of reading material. Cut out pictures that represents your dreams. Glue the pictures in a journal. Write about them. Why do you want that dream? What do you have to do to accomplish that dream? How can you make it happen? Design your journal with stickers, glitter, paints, and other scrapbook materials.
